むさぼる
Meanings, readings, and example sentences for the Japanese word むさぼる.
Dictionary
Entry
1
to covet; to crave; to be greedy for; to hunger for; to lust insatiably for
2
to indulge in; to do ceaselessly; to keep doing (without losing interest)
Examples
いいのよ。いままで実のないブランド品を高く売りつけて暴利をむさぼってきたんだから。今後せいぜい良心的な商売にはげめばいいんだわ。
Never mind that. After all, up till now he's been stuffing himself on huge profits, selling brand-name goods of no real worth at high prices. From now on, he can just try his best at honest trade.
3
to eat greedily; to devour
Examples
お腹を空かせたその男は、食物をむさぼり食った。
The starving man devoured the food.
